Job description

General Purpose

The Business Development Representative is responsible for calling on a pipeline of customer prospects for TPx's cloud-based products and services. This position works closely with Marketing and other sales/business development groups to achieve success metrics, drive revenue gains, and execute outreach strategies. Essential Duties and Responsibilities


  • Manages campaigns and cadences to identify Sales Qualified Leads

  • Initiates contact with potential customers through cold-calling prospects who have been contacted via other business development methods, or responding to inquiries generated from advertisements

  • Develops sales strategies to draw in potential customers or to solicit new potential customers

  • Identifies pain points, priorities, and business compatibility

  • Conveys how products and solutions can help achieve business communication goals

  • Converts prospects to sales-qualified leads or opportunities for the sales team by scheduling discovery meetings between qualified leads and Account Executives or senior sales representatives

  • Fosters relationships with customers to identify their potential needs and qualify their interest

  • Meets or exceeds monthly, quarterly, and annual appointment-setting goals


Other Responsibilities


  • Collaborates with the Marketing team to write, test, and optimize call scripts and sequential follow-up communications

  • Tracks and reports marketing qualification within Salesforce

  • Helps maintain and enrich the Salesforce database

  • Performs other duties as assigned
